We are putting together a club trip to the Bridgeport area. These are our preliminary plans.
As we firm up details we will provide updated plans in future Club Newsletters or through email. The trip will be from Sunday, September 29th, fishing Monday, Tuesday and Wednesday, and returning home on Thursday, October 3rd.
The trip will be one that allows “free planning” on where you want to fish and whether you want to hire a guide or fish on your own. There are numerous great fishing opportunities in that area, including stream fishing the East Walker, West Walker and Robinson Creek. Also, fishing by boat, float tube or from the shore on Bridgeport Reservoir, Upper or Lower Twin Lakes or float tubing on the Virginia Lakes.
We will provide you with a list of guides in the area and contact information for boat rentals. You will need to make your own reservations ahead of the start of the trip.
We are researching lodging options and will let you know where we would like to stay as a group. Once we do this and have names of participants we will reserve the rooms for the group. We are also researching restaurants and will provide these details when available.
We believe the Bridgeport area offers wonderful and varied fishing opportunities for the club and hope you will join us in the inaugural trip, which we plan to limit to a lucky dozen.
